City Engages in Welcoming Leadership Event
Rachel Joy, Director of the Equity and Engagement Department, participated as a guest speaker during the Welcoming America Certified Leadership 2025 cohort final session. The session, entitled “Sustaining and Growing Welcoming Infrastructure”, was held on Thursday, October 9. The Leadership cohort included communities from California, Colorado, Illinois, Massachusetts, Missouri,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vania, and Utah.

Champaign County Community Coalition Meeting
The Champaign County Community Coalition held its monthly meeting on September 10 at the Holiday Inn Conference Center. This month’s meeting focused on the theme “Addressing our Juvenile Justice Crisis” and featured four panel discussions exploring different facets of the issue.
